The Itinerary in Detail
Start at 9:00 AM with hotel pickup. From your accommodation, you’ll set off on a scenic drive along the coast, passing through well-known beaches like Patong, Karon, and Kata. This initial stretch gives you a taste of Phuket’s vibrant beach scene and lush landscapes, setting a relaxed tone for the day.
Stop 1: Big Buddha Phuket. This is arguably the most iconic landmark. However, some reviews mention a caveat: the Big Buddha is not accessible for interior visits, and you’re only able to see it from outside. One reviewer noted being driven close but not allowed inside, which could be a letdown if you’re expecting a close-up experience. Still, the view from the surrounding area offers decent photo opportunities and panoramic vistas.
Stop 2: Karon Viewpoint. Known for its postcard-worthy scenery, this viewpoint overlooks three beaches—Karon, Kata, and Patong. Expect to spend about 50 minutes here, soaking in views that are perfect for photos. It’s a popular spot, so be prepared for other travelers, but the vantage points are worth it.
Stop 3: Old Phuket Town. The city’s historic quarter is a highlight for many. During the 50-minute walk, you’ll encounter colorful Sino-Portuguese architecture, quaint streets, and local shops. One reviewer pointed out that this part of the tour offers a glimpse into Phuket’s colonial past, with some noting it’s a good place for souvenir shopping and street photography.
Visit to Local Factories. The tour includes stops at a cashew nut factory and a local factory. These visits add a tangible element to the cultural experience, giving insight into local craftsmanship and production. Refreshments like soft drinks, coffee, or tea are offered at the factory stops, providing a nice break.
Optional Thai Lunch. The tour provides an opportunity for an authentic Thai meal on the beach—though this is listed as optional. If you choose to indulge, it’s a flavorful way to connect with local cuisine, but be aware that the lunch isn’t included in the base price.
Return to Hotel around 2:00 PM, completing the circuit with relaxed timing.

Travel Pace and Timing
The pace is generally relaxed, with about 50-minute stops at each major site, allowing enough time for photos and brief exploration. However, some reviews suggest the experience can feel rushed, especially if the group is large or the traffic is heavy during peak hours.

What Could Be Improved?
The biggest drawback, based on reviews, is the limited access to Big Buddha—you can only view it from outside and get a quick photo. If you’re hoping for an in-depth visit or a more spiritual experience, this will be disappointing. Similarly, some travelers felt the overall experience was a bit “typical,” lacking a deeper cultural or local flavor.
